Key Factors in Sports Bra Construction

Material Selection and Performance

The foundation of any sports bra lies in its fabric. High-performance materials such as nylon, polyester, and spandex are commonly used due to their moisture-wicking, breathability, and four-way stretch properties. The choice of fabric impacts not only comfort but also the bra's ability to provide adequate support during physical activity.

  • Moisture Management: Fabrics that wick sweat away from the skin help regulate body temperature and prevent chafing.
  • Compression vs. Encapsulation: Compression bras flatten the chest to limit movement, while encapsulation bras use separate cups for individual support. Many modern designs combine both techniques for optimal performance.
  • Seam Construction: Flatlock seams reduce irritation, while bonded seams offer a smooth, invisible finish.
  • Support Levels and Impact Activities

    Sports bras are categorized by the level of support they offer, typically ranging from low to high impact. The construction must align with the intended activity:

  • Low Impact: Yoga, Pilates, and stretching – lighter fabrics, minimal structure.
  • Medium Impact: Cycling, hiking, and gym workouts – moderate compression and wider straps.
  • High Impact: Running, HIIT, and aerobics – maximum support, reinforced bands, and adjustable features.
  • Design and Fit

    A well-constructed sports bra must accommodate diverse body shapes and sizes. Key design elements include:

  • Underband: A firm, elastic band that provides primary support and should sit snugly without digging.
  • Straps: Adjustable or racerback designs to distribute weight evenly and prevent slippage.
  • Closure: Hook-and-eye closures or front zippers for ease of wear, often seen in high-support models.
  • OEM vs. ODM in Sports Bra Manufacturing

    Understanding OEM (Original Equipment Manufacturing)

    In an OEM arrangement, the buyer provides the design and specifications, and the manufacturer produces the product according to those exact requirements. This model is ideal for brands with existing designs or those looking to protect proprietary innovations. Key considerations include:

  • Design Ownership: The buyer retains intellectual property rights.
  • Customization: Materials, colors, and branding can be fully customized.
  • Lead Time: Typically longer due to the need for prototyping and sampling.
  • Understanding ODM (Original Design Manufacturing)

    ODM involves the manufacturer offering pre-designed products that the buyer can customize with their branding. This is a faster, cost-effective option for new entrants or brands seeking to expand their product lines quickly. Advantages include:

  • Reduced Development Time: Existing designs are ready for production.
  • Lower Costs: No design fees, and economies of scale in material sourcing.
  • Flexibility: Minor modifications can be made to suit brand aesthetics.
  • Choosing Between OEM and ODM

    The decision depends on your brand's maturity, budget, and need for uniqueness.     The Role of MOQ in Manufacturing

    What is MOQ and Why Does It Matter?

    MOQ (Minimum Order Quantity) is the smallest number of units a manufacturer is willing to produce in a single order. It directly impacts pricing, production efficiency, and inventory management. Higher MOQs typically result in lower per-unit costs due to economies of scale, but they require more significant capital investment.

    Factors Influencing MOQ

  • Material Sourcing: Custom fabrics and colors often necessitate larger minimums.
  • Production Setup: Each style requires specific patterns, cutting, and sewing setups, which are more cost-effective in larger batches.
  • Supplier Constraints: Manufacturers may have minimums to justify raw material purchases and factory time.
  • Strategies to Manage MOQ

  • Standardization: Using common fabrics and trims across multiple styles can reduce MOQ.
  • Pre-orders and Crowdfunding: Gauge demand before committing to large quantities.

  • Quality Control in Sports Bra Production

    Importance of Quality Control

    Quality control (QC) ensures that every sports bra meets specified standards for performance, safety, and durability. In the fitness apparel industry, a malfunctioning bra can lead to customer dissatisfaction and brand damage. Rigorous QC processes are non-negotiable.

    Key QC Checkpoints

  • Incoming Materials: Inspect fabrics, elastics, and hardware for defects.
  • In-Process Inspection: Monitor cutting, sewing, and assembly to catch issues early.
  • Final Random Inspection: Before shipping, a sample of finished goods is checked for:
  • - Stitching integrity

    - Elastic recovery

    - Colorfastness

    - Dimensional stability

    - Overall appearance

    Testing Standards and Certifications

    Adherence to international standards is crucial. Common certifications include:

  • OEKO-TEX® Standard 100: Ensures textiles are free from harmful substances.
  • ISO 9001: Quality management systems.
  • ASTM D5586: Performance specifications for knit fabrics.

    Common Mistakes in Sports Bra Manufacturing

    Overlooking Fit and Sizing

    One of the most common errors is neglecting proper fit testing across diverse body types. A bra that fits one person perfectly may not suit another. Conducting extensive fit trials with a range of sizes is essential.

    Choosing the Wrong Fabric

    Selecting fabric solely on cost or appearance without considering performance can lead to poor moisture management, discomfort, and premature wear. Always test fabrics for stretch, recovery, and breathability.

    Inadequate Quality Control

    Skipping QC steps to save time or money can result in defective products that harm your brand's reputation. Implement a robust QC plan from the outset.

    Ignoring MOQ Constraints

    Failing to plan for MOQ can cause budget overruns or supply chain delays. Understand your manufacturer's MOQ requirements early and factor them into your business plan.

    Not Communicating Clearly with Your Manufacturer

    Misunderstandings regarding specifications, timelines, and expectations can be costly. Maintain open, detailed communication with your manufacturing partner to ensure alignment.
